Pneumatic fittings are available in a variety of varieties to go well with numerous utility necessities:
- Push-to-Connect Fittings: Push-to-connect fittings enable for fast and tool-free set up by merely pushing the tubing or hose into the fitting, the place it is held in place by inside gripping mechanisms.
- Compression Fittings: Compression fittings utilize compression rings or ferrules to safe tubing or hose onto the fitting body, providing a leak-proof seal by compressing the becoming onto the tubing.
- Barbed Fittings: Barbed fittings feature barbs or ridges on the fitting physique that grip onto the inside diameter of the tubing or hose, creating a safe connection when tightened with a hose clamp or crimp becoming.
- Threaded Fittings: Threaded fittings have threads on the fitting body that screw onto threaded ports or adapters, offering a secure connection and permitting for simple disassembly and reassembly.
- Quick-Disconnect Couplings: Quick-disconnect couplings allow for rapid connection and disconnection of pneumatic elements with a easy push or pull motion, perfect for purposes requiring frequent adjustments or maintenance.

Pneumatic fittings are important elements utilized in air compression methods to attach, control, and route compressed air between pneumatic elements similar to valves, cylinders, hoses, and air instruments. These fittings provide a safe, leak-proof connection whereas allowing for fast installation, disassembly, and upkeep of pneumatic systems.
